X188 GGX is a 2001 Gilera Dna in Yellow with a 49c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 2 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 2001 Gilera Dna models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.6% with a typical mileage of 8,102 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Gilera Dna fails its MOT is shock absorber seal failed and leaking oil, accounting for 1,269 recorded failures. If you're considering buying X188 GGX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Gilera Dna typ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 25 years old, this Gilera Dna is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
